Column: Pritzker sparring with unusual partner over new crime law – Champaign News-Gazette*

Jim Dey: "Both men are exaggerating, (Will County State’s Attorney James) Glasgow by a little, but (Gov. JB) Pritzker by a lot. The problem is that voters, who know little about intricacies of the criminal-justice system, are in no position to judge."
